How Blogging Can Help Your Lawn Care Business Thrive

  1. Showcase Your Expertise: By writing informative posts about lawn maintenance, pest control, or seasonal care tips, you establish yourself as an expert in the field. Potential clients will trust your skills and knowledge, much like how the gardener earned trust through sharing her plant stories.

  2. Build Relationships: Blogging allows you to connect with your audience on a personal level. Share stories about your experiences in lawn care or customer success stories. This personal touch helps people feel more connected to your brand.

  3. Utilize Visuals: Lawn care is a visual business. Use your blog to showcase before-and-after photos of your work. Just as the gardener displayed her beautiful plants, showing off your results will attract attention.

  4. SEO Benefits: Writing regular blog posts can improve your search engine rankings. This means more potential customers will find you online. Think of it like planting seeds that will grow into a beautiful lawn — the more you plant, the more your customers will come.

  5. Create a Community: Invite your readers to share their lawn care stories or ask questions. This creates a community around your blog, which encourages engagement and loyalty.
